Brief summary
The overall aim of the proposed project is to improve muscle strength in older adults with possible sarcopenia by promoting home-based progressive resistance exercise. The target population for health talks is community-dwelling older adults. A Three monthly home-visits and weekly phone calls will be made. A waitlist randomised controlled trial will be conducted to evaluate effectiveness, and qualitative feedback will be collected from participants. A pilot study will be conducted first.
Interventions
The intervention is to be taught by fitness trainer at the participants' home at the start of each phase. The exercise progression model for older adults recommended by the American College of Sports Medicine, which emphasise gradual increments in training load and systematically alter one or more programme components, will be adopted.

Eligibility
Inclusion criteria
The inclusion criteria are: * Aged 65-89; * Possible sarcopenia (defined by AWGS 2019); * No cognitive impairment (Abbreviated Mental Test score ≥8); and * No communication problems. The
Exclusion criteria
are: * having engaged in a structured exercise programme in the past 6 months or planning to do so within the intervention period; * mobility-limiting injury of the hands or lower limbs, surgery or hospitalisation within the intervention period; * contraindications such as musculoskeletal/cardiorespiratory disorders, or any advanced diseases that inhibit them from exercising.
